IDnsConfigFork Interface
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Fork permettant d’accéder à la création ou de spécifier la configuration DNS.
public interface IDnsConfigFork : Microsoft.Azure.Management.ContainerInstance.Fluent.ContainerGroup.Definition.IWithCreate, Microsoft.Azure.Management.ContainerInstance.Fluent.ContainerGroup.Definition.IWithDnsConfig, Microsoft.Azure.Management.ResourceManager.Fluent.Core.IBeta, Microsoft.Azure.Management.ResourceManager.Fluent.Core.Resource.Definition.IDefinitionWithTags<Microsoft.Azure.Management.ContainerInstance.Fluent.ContainerGroup.Definition.IWithCreate>, Microsoft.Azure.Management.ResourceManager.Fluent.Core.ResourceActions.ICreatable<Microsoft.Azure.Management.ContainerInstance.Fluent.IContainerGroup>
type IDnsConfigFork = interface
interface IWithDnsConfig
interface IWithDnsConfigBeta
interface IBeta
interface IWithCreate
interface IWithRestartPolicy
interface IWithRestartPolicyBeta
interface IWithSystemAssignedManagedServiceIdentity
interface IWithSystemAssignedManagedServiceIdentityBeta
interface IWithUserAssignedManagedServiceIdentity
interface IWithUserAssignedManagedServiceIdentityBeta
interface IWithDnsPrefix
interface IWithNetworkProfile
interface IWithNetworkProfileBeta
interface IWithLogAnalytics
interface IWithLogAnalyticsBeta
interface ICreatable<IContainerGroup>
interface IIndexable
interface IDefinitionWithTags<IWithCreate>
Public Interface IDnsConfigFork
Implements IBeta, ICreatable(Of IContainerGroup), IDefinitionWithTags(Of IWithCreate), IWithCreate, IWithDnsConfig
- Dérivé
- Implémente
-
IWithCreate IWithDnsConfig IWithDnsConfigBeta IWithDnsPrefix IWithLogAnalytics IWithLogAnalyticsBeta IWithNetworkProfile IWithNetworkProfileBeta IWithRestartPolicy IWithRestartPolicyBeta IWithSystemAssignedManagedServiceIdentity IWithSystemAssignedManagedServiceIdentityBeta IWithUserAssignedManagedServiceIdentity IWithUserAssignedManagedServiceIdentityBeta IBeta IDefinitionWithTags<IWithCreate> ICreatable<IContainerGroup> IIndexable
Propriétés
Key |
Fork permettant d’accéder à la création ou de spécifier la configuration DNS. (Hérité de IIndexable) |
Name |
Obtient le nom de la ressource créatable. (Hérité de ICreatable<T>) |
Méthodes
Create() |
Exécutez la demande de création. (Hérité de ICreatable<T>) |
CreateAsync(CancellationToken, Boolean) |
Place la requête dans la file d’attente et autorise le client HTTP à l’exécuter lorsque des ressources système sont disponibles. (Hérité de ICreatable<T>) |
WithDnsConfiguration(IList<String>, String, String) |
Spécifie la configuration DNS pour le groupe de conteneurs. (Hérité de IWithDnsConfigBeta) |
WithDnsPrefix(String) |
Spécifie le préfixe DNS à utiliser pour créer le nom de domaine complet du groupe de conteneurs. (Hérité de IWithDnsPrefix) |
WithDnsServerNames(IList<String>) |
Spécifie les serveurs DNS pour le groupe de conteneurs. (Hérité de IWithDnsConfigBeta) |
WithExistingUserAssignedManagedServiceIdentity(IIdentity) |
Spécifie une identité affectée par l’utilisateur existante à associer au groupe de conteneurs. (Hérité de IWithUserAssignedManagedServiceIdentityBeta) |
WithLogAnalytics(String, String) |
Spécifie l’espace de travail Log Analytics à utiliser pour le groupe de conteneurs. (Hérité de IWithLogAnalyticsBeta) |
WithLogAnalytics(String, String, LogAnalyticsLogType, IDictionary<String,String>) |
Spécifie l’espace de travail Log Analytics avec des modules complémentaires facultatifs pour le groupe de conteneurs. (Hérité de IWithLogAnalyticsBeta) |
WithNetworkProfileId(String, String, String) |
Spécifie les informations de profil réseau pour un groupe de conteneurs. (Hérité de IWithNetworkProfileBeta) |
WithNewUserAssignedManagedServiceIdentity(ICreatable<IIdentity>) |
Spécifie la définition d’une identité affectée par l’utilisateur non encore créée à associer à la machine virtuelle. (Hérité de IWithUserAssignedManagedServiceIdentityBeta) |
WithRestartPolicy(ContainerGroupRestartPolicy) |
Spécifie la stratégie de redémarrage pour toutes les instances de conteneur au sein du groupe de conteneurs. (Hérité de IWithRestartPolicyBeta) |
WithSystemAssignedManagedServiceIdentity() |
Spécifie une identité de service managé affectée par le système pour le groupe de conteneurs. (Hérité de IWithSystemAssignedManagedServiceIdentityBeta) |
WithTag(String, String) |
Ajoute une balise à la ressource. (Hérité de IDefinitionWithTags<T>) |
WithTags(IDictionary<String,String>) |
Spécifie des balises pour la ressource en tant que {@link Map}. (Hérité de IDefinitionWithTags<T>) |
S’applique à
Azure SDK for .NET